Hiking area featuring trails for all levels, as well as mountain biking, and horseback riding.
What runners say about Soderberg Trailhead
“Beautiful trail system with access to the mountains and also a lower trail that’s a bit easier with less elevation change.”
This is a great hike for beginners with terrific views from the new Nomad Stout connector trail.
Great trails close to town at this Trailhead. Small parking lot, so get there early, and includes bathrooms. Trail system there is just incredible. You can take a trail down to the lake, or take one of many that head up, up to Horsetooth or other destinations.
This is a great trail for beginners or anyone looking for something easy. It has minimal elevation gain and the trail is smooth dirt the whole way. It's accessible for people, bikes, and horses. It's $10 for the day and the lot has a lot of room.
Great trails for hiking and biking. Bikers were exceptionally polite and well manored towards hikers. Good views. Many different difficulty ratings.
